Arizona State completes three-game sweep of UCLA

Arizona State, ranked No. 3 by Baseball America, completed a three-game Pacific 10 Conference sweep of No. 5 UCLA on Sunday with a 12-3 victory at Jackie Robinson Stadium.

The Sun Devils (38-5, 14-4) had three players hit two-run home runs -- Zack MacPhee, Kole Calhoun and Raoul Torrez, all against starter Rob Rasmussen (6-2).

UCLA (30-10, 7-8) is 8-10 since starting the season 22-0. Arizona State leads the Pac-10, followed by California (11-7), Stanford (10-8), Oregon (10-8) and Washington (8-7).
